David Nahmani Posted April 9, 2021 Share Posted April 9, 2021 Is it possible you trashed your preferences and your advanced tools are disabled? That changes the behavior when changing File > New: when advanced tools are not enabled, that opens the Template chooser, but when advanced tools are enabled, that opens a new project directly. On the other hand, choosing File > Open (in case that's what you meant by "clicked Open") always opens a Finder browser from where you choose the project you want to open. It never opens the Template chooser, so my guess is you chose File > New.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
